- What is Mettler-Toledo International, Inc.'s us operations segment member — net sales?
- Mettler-Toledo International, Inc. (MTD) reported us operations segment member — net sales of $382.34M in Q1 2026.
- How has Mettler-Toledo International, Inc.'s us operations segment member — net sales changed year-over-year?
- Mettler-Toledo International, Inc.'s us operations segment member — net sales increased by 0.7% year-over-year, from $379.85M to $382.34M.
- What is the long-term trend for Mettler-Toledo International, Inc.'s us operations segment member — net sales?
- Over 3 years (2022 to 2025), Mettler-Toledo International, Inc.'s us operations segment member — net sales has grown at a 1.0%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$1.6B to $1.65B.
- What does us operations segment member — net sales mean?
- The net revenue generated by the U.S. operations segment after accounting for returns, allowances, and discounts. This is the primary measure of the segment's realized commercial value from its market activities. It is essential for calculating segment-level profitability and assessing the segment's competitive position.
